Second by Ms. Hart. Motion approved. 5. Library Website There is no update on this item. H. New Business 6. MCFLS Update The MCFLS officers remain the same. MCFLS will be using some reserve funds to match state funds to support the Milwaukee County Jail and the Vel R. Phillips Juvenile Justice Center efforts to create libraries for their inmates. 7. Library Director's Report - Part of the Library roof has been replaced. -Winter Reading for all ages will run from December 16th to March 1st. Patrons can sign up in person or online. -The Library received a final donation totaling $227,000 from the estate of Marion Jane Ellert. -The Children's Department has a new program called Barks and Books. Children in 5K-5th grade can read to therapy dogs. Julia Fischer, Children's Librarian, created the program. J. Adjournment There being no further business, Ms. Hart moved to adjourn.
